Pugal is a small town in the Bikaner district of Rajasthan, India. It is also the headquarters of the tehsil in the Khajuwala Sub-division with the same name.[1]
Geography
Pugal is located at 28°30′00″N 72°48′0″E / 28.50000°N 72.80000°E. It has an average elevation of 145 metres (869 feet).[2]
Demographics
As of 2001 India census, Pugal had a population of 6,314. Males constitute 3,416 of the population and females 2,898. [3]
